Where is the Rayter family from?

You can see how Rayter families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Rayter family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1911 and 1920. The most Rayter families were found in USA in 1920, and Canada in 1911. In 1911 there were 3 Rayter families living in Prince Edward Island. This was 100% of all the recorded Rayter's in Canada. Prince Edward Island had the highest population of Rayter families in 1911.
